Chimp Crazy Episode “Head Shot” Explores Ethics and Relationships

The third episode of “Chimp Crazy,” titled “Head Shot,” is set to air on HBOMOV at 12:37 PM on July 11, 2026. This episode promises to deliver intense drama as actor Alan Cumming, known for his captivating performances, adds a significant twist to the storyline by contributing an additional $10,000 to the reward for the whereabouts of Tonka. The stakes are high, and the emotional weight of this episode is sure to resonate with viewers.

As the film crew delves deeper into the search for Tonka, they find themselves grappling with an ethical dilemma that draws parallels to a previous case involving PETA. This connection to a dangerous incident in Oregon adds layers to the narrative, prompting both the characters and the audience to reflect on the complexities of animal rights and the responsibilities of those who document these stories.
